Found meat in a product labelled with Green Dot (Veg). Can I sue the company?

Bought a food product from a big brand. Outer packaging had a **Green Dot (Vegetarian)**. After eating, found **multiple meat chunks** inside — apparently from a flavour sachet included in the box.

The outer box clearly shows a Green Dot, which under **FSSAI regulations** means the entire product is veg. Including a non-veg component inside seems like a direct violation.

I'm a vegetarian and this is both a religious violation and a labelling fraud for me.

Can I file a consumer complaint or FSSAI complaint? Any grounds to sue?
